How to Send A Link from Chrome

The process to send a link from Chrome on one device to other devices is easy. If you use Chrome on more than one device, you can follow the steps below to send a link or tab from your desktop.

Send A Link or Tab from Computer to Phone

On the desktop, sending links from Chrome to other devices is as easy as a right-click. You can send a link from your computer to any other computer or mobile device. This works across Windows, macOS, Chrome OS, and Linux too. So you can say, send links from Chrome on your Mac or PC to your Android.how to send link from Chrome to other devices

  1. Open a web page that you want to send in Chrome.
  2. It can also be the web page that has the link you want to send.
  3. Right-click on a link or an open tab in Chrome that you want to send. 
  4. Move the cursor over to the option Send to your devices / Send link to your devices / Send tab to your devices.
  5. You’ll then see a list of all the devices that fulfill the aforementioned criteria. 
  6. Click on the device that you want to send the link or tab to. 

Chrome send link from phone to desktop notification

If you’ve sent a link to your desktop from another desktop or phone you should see a notification. What it looks like will depend on your desktop OS.

Send A Tab from Android to PC or Mac

It’s easy to send a link from the Android Chrome browser to Pc or even Mac. All you have to do is share. You can send an open link from Chrome to Android, iOS, iPadOS, macOS, Windows, Chrome OS, or Linux devices.

Send link from Chrome on Android to other devices
  1. Open a web page or link you want to send in Chrome.
  2. Tap on the three-dot menu button in Chrome and select Share.
  3. The Android share menu will then appear.
  4. You will see two options with the Chrome icon.
  5. Tap on the one that says Send to your devices.
  6. Tap on one of the available devices from the list that you want to send the link or tab to.
Chrome send link from desktop to phone notification

On mobile devices such as Android, you can share an open tab in Chrome but not any link on a page. If you long-press on a link and tap Share, you can share it with other apps on your phone but you don’t get the option to Send to your devices. If you’ve sent a link to your Android device from another device, you will see a notification as shown above.

Send A Tab from Chrome on iPadOS

The concept is pretty much the same on iPadOS as it is on Android. You can still send a link from Chrome to iPhone, Android, macOS, Windows, Linux, or Chrome OS. But the execution is slightly different. On Chrome for iPad, you get a dedicated share button right next to the address bar.

how to send link from iPad to PC
  1. Open the tab that you want to send to another device.
  2. Tap on the Share button at the top on Chrome for iPad.
  3. In the Share menu select the Sent to your devices option.
  4. Next, select the device you want to send the link to.
  5. Tap on the blue Send to your devices button at the bottom.
select device to send link from iPad

This way you can even send links from your iPad to a PC or Android.

Chrome send link from phone or desktop to iPad notification

 

If you’ve sent a link from another device to your iPad, you will have to open Chrome. When you do, you should see a little notification at the bottom as shown above.

Sending links and tabs from Chrome

We’ve seen how easy it is to share links between your devices using Chrome. You can send links from the phone to the computer or vice-versa and even from the iPad to any other device. There are some things you’ll need to consider, however. Any device that you want to send the link from or to should have Chrome installed. Moreover, you should be signed into Chrome using the same Google ID on both the devices.

Only some time ago if you needed to share links from Chrome to other devices, you’d have to depend on third-party extensions and apps. Some like Pushbullet were even paid services. But today, you get this feature baked right into Chrome. There are still some kinks for Chrome to iron out. But this feature makes Chrome truly a cross-platform browser.
